WorléeAdd 327 is a silicone-based paint additive designed for use in both solvent-based and water-thinnable air-drying and stoving coatings. Here's an overview of its features and usage instructions:
Application and Properties: WorléeAdd 327 offers several benefits at low concentrations:
It is particularly recommended to add 0.2% of WorléeAdd 327 in water-thinnable high-gloss top coats based on WorléeSol 61, 65, 85, etc.
Usage Instructions: WorléeAdd 327 can be added to ready paints or lacquers, with typical concentration ranging from 0.1% to 1.5%, calculated on the total formulation.
Recoatability: It is advisable to test coatings containing WorléeAdd 327 for recoatability, especially in stoving systems.
Caution: WorléeAdd 327 is supplied in a solvent that is easily flammable (isopropanol). Therefore, it should be kept away from heat and open flame during handling and storage. Additionally, the product may become cloudy at low temperatures but can be restored to its clear state by warming it up to room temperature and homogenizing it, without affecting its quality.
